UE23-2MF2D3 Equivalent & Substitute Parts

Part Overview

The UE23-2MF2D3 is a safety relay manufactured by SICK, Inc., configured as a 3PST (3-pole single-throw) unit with 6A contact rating and 24VDC coil voltage. This component is classified as obsolete, making identification of functionally equivalent alternatives necessary for system maintenance and new design implementations. The relay features screw terminal connections and operates on DIN rail mounting systems, with contact materials composed of silver and gold for enhanced reliability in safety-critical applications.

Substitute Part Grouping Explanation

Substitution of the UE23-2MF2D3 is based on alignment of the following critical parameters:

  • Coil Voltage: 24VDC (primary control signal requirement)
  • Contact Rating: 6 A (load-carrying capacity)
  • Mounting Type: DIN Rail (physical installation compatibility)
  • Contact Material: Silver/Gold composition (reliability and conductivity)
  • Manufacturer: SICK, Inc. (design continuity and support)

The identified substitute part RLY3-EMSS1 maintains compatibility across coil voltage, current rating, mounting type, and contact material specifications. However, differences exist in contact form configuration (DPST-NO versus 3PST-2NO/1NC), termination style (Spring Terminal versus Screw Terminal), and switching voltage maximum (250VDC versus 300VDC). These differences must be evaluated within the context of the specific application circuit.

Engineering Selection Recommendations

The RLY3-EMSS1 is an active product from SICK, Inc., providing supply continuity for applications currently using the obsolete UE23-2MF2D3. Both components share identical coil voltage (24VDC), contact current rating (6 A), mounting configuration (DIN Rail), and contact material composition (Silver/Gold).

Selection of RLY3-EMSS1 as a substitute requires circuit-level evaluation of the following factors:

  • Contact Form Difference: The main part provides 3PST configuration (2 normally-open, 1 normally-closed contact), while the substitute provides DPST configuration (2 normally-open contacts only). Applications requiring normally-closed contact functionality must implement alternative circuit design.

  • Termination Compatibility: The main part uses screw terminals; the substitute uses spring terminals. Installation procedures and wiring practices must be adapted accordingly.

  • Switching Voltage: The main part supports 300VDC maximum switching voltage; the substitute supports 250VDC maximum. Applications operating at voltages between 250VDC and 300VDC are not compatible with the substitute.

  • Response Time: The substitute exhibits significantly faster operate time (10 ms versus 80 ms), which may affect circuit timing in applications dependent on the original relay's response characteristics.

Both components maintain EAR99 export classification and HTSUS code 8536.41.0020 compliance.

Frequently Asked Questions (FAQ)

Q: Can RLY3-EMSS1 directly replace UE23-2MF2D3 in existing installations?

A: Direct replacement is possible only if the application circuit does not require the normally-closed contact provided by the main part's 3PST configuration, does not operate at switching voltages exceeding 250VDC, and can accommodate spring terminal connections. The faster operate time of the substitute (10 ms versus 80 ms) must be verified as compatible with circuit timing requirements.

Q: What is the primary difference between these two relay models?

A: The main difference is contact form configuration. The UE23-2MF2D3 provides 3PST-2NO/1NC (two normally-open and one normally-closed contact), while the RLY3-EMSS1 provides DPST-NO (two normally-open contacts only). This affects circuit design and control logic implementation.
